Leah Rollins 1754–1830 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 7 Sep 1754

Birth Location: Newington, Rockingham, New Hampshire, United States

Death Date: 1830

Death Location: Farmington, Strafford, New Hampshire, United States

Father: Edward Rawlins

Mother: Elizabeth Nutter

Spouse(s): Simon French

Children(s): Edmund French

The story of Leah Rollins began in 1754 in Newington, Rockingham, New Hampshire, United States. Leah Rollins married Simon French, and had children including Edmund French. Leah Rollins passed away in 1830 in Farmington, Strafford, New Hampshire, United States.
